Clayton James Hicks, Jr.

EDMOND —     C. Jim Hicks, 76, of Edmond, Okla., was born December 9, 1935 in Oklahoma City, Okla., the son of Clayton and Lucille Hicks. He was promoted from this life on November 7, 2012 in Oklahoma City.

    Jim has stated that his greatest achievement in life was receiving the Lord Jesus Christ as his personal Savior, and he was serving Him as an active member of Quail Springs Baptist Church. Jim grew up in the Oklahoma City area, attending Capital Hill High School, graduating in 1954. Jim attended the University of Oklahoma, worked for his father at Advance Plumbing and Heating Co., then later for Matherly Mechanical Contractors. In 1978 Jim moved to Lawton, Okla., to partner with the J.C. Hester Co., retiring in 1991. He returned to Matherly Mechanical Contractors where he again retired in 2002.

    Jim served in the Oklahoma Air National Guard 205th for 21 years, retiring as SMSGT/E8. He was a 56 year member of the United Association of Plumbers and Pipefitters. Jim served on the State committee which co-authored the Oklahoma Mechanical Licensing Act.

    His parents, Clayton and Lucille Hicks preceded him in death.

    Jim is survived by his wife Kaye of their home; sister Marilyn Smith; brother Tom Hicks and wife Connie; brother John Hicks and wife Cheryl; son Clay Hicks and wife Gayle; son Jeff Hicks and wife Cindy; daughter Denise Shepard and husband Steve; as well as many grandchildren, nieces, nephews, and friends.
